Discover how singing, playing and movement are interconnected and lay the foundation for your development and understanding within music.
I am a trained 'Sing, Play and Move' teacher, and in my teaching I strive to create a creative and relaxed space where there is room to both learn focused and nerd out about details, but also to be able to turn off the brain and let the body learn.
The workshop can be a one-off boost for your students, choir or music colleagues. We can start from scratch, go in depth with a specific challenge, or we can tailor a longer course. The teaching is always adapted to the participants and the given framework, and is for both larger and smaller groups.

Who is the workshop aimed at?
MGK & conservatory students who want to strengthen their musical understanding and ability.
Choirs that want to become even more groovy and united in sound together!
Music teachers who need new inputs or want to strengthen their own skills to be able to stand more confidently in front of students.
